History
MComix originated as a fork of the Comix project, which was itself a popular comic book reader. The software was developed to address some of the limitations of Comix and to introduce new features that cater to the evolving needs of comic book readers. Since its inception, MComix has seen regular updates and improvements, thanks in part to contributions from a dedicated community of developers and users. The software is cross-platform, available for Windows and Linux, which has helped it gain traction in various user communities.
Features
MComix is packed with features that enhance the comic reading experience:
- Wide Format Support: MComix supports a variety of comic book formats, including CBR, CBZ, PDF, and more.
- User-Friendly Interface: The interface is intuitive, making it easy for users to navigate through their comic collections.
- Customizable Viewing Options: Users can adjust the viewing layout, zoom levels, and page transitions to suit their preferences.
- Bookmarks and Annotations: Readers can bookmark pages and make annotations, allowing for easy reference and note-taking.
- Image Extraction: MComix allows users to extract images from comic files, which can be useful for sharing or using artwork outside of the reader.
- Full-Screen Mode: For an immersive reading experience, MComix offers a full-screen mode that eliminates distractions.
- Library Management: Users can organize their comic collections with tags and filters, making it easy to find specific titles.
- Multi-language Support: MComix is available in multiple languages, catering to a global audience.

Supported File Formats
MComix supports a variety of comic book file formats, including: - CBR (Comic Book RAR) - CBZ (Comic Book ZIP) - PDF (Portable Document Format) - CB7 (Comic Book 7z) - EPUB (Electronic Publication)
